    Question

    Monthly income of A is Rs. 50000 out of which he spent

    25%, 12% and 22% of his total income in rent, medicine and transportation, respectively. Find his expenditure on given three items.
    A Rs. 40000 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
    B Rs. 29500 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
    C Rs. 33000 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
    D Rs. 50250 Correct Answer Incorrect Answer

    Solution

    Required expenditure = (0.25 + 0.12 + 0.22) × 50000 = Rs. 29500
